Derek Kellogg was my first choice to replace Travis Ford. Kellogg is a UMass alum, played for John Calipari and has been coaching with him for six years. He is a good recruiter and was named a top 10 assistant coach by Rivals.com. Memphis and UMass played a similar offensive system and so the transition should be smooth. I would guess that Kellogg and UMass are on the same page with contract terms given his connections with the school. This is a great choice for UMass and I expect them to continue the improvement that Ford started.
